Sash windows

Sash windows are a more traditional type of window. They feature frames that hold the glass, glazing bars and muntins and are usually operated with cords and weights that open or close them. This type of window could be a great option for homes seeking to be energy efficient and distinctive. Sash windows come in a variety of materials, including aluminum and vinyl. The material that you choose should be determined by the style you prefer, your maintenance requirements, durability and energy efficiency.

Window replacement of sash is a fantastic alternative for older homes that require to boost their energy efficiency. A good quality sash window will be able to keep heat in and reduce draughts. It should also be able secure itself, stopping intrusion by criminals. Sash windows come in a wide variety of styles and sizes, from traditional to modern.

Bay windows

Bay windows are a great addition to any house, offering more space and allowing for more natural light. They can also enhance the value of your property and create a unique focal-point in your home. You can pick from a variety of styles and colours to find the one that is best for your needs.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gBay windows frames can be made of uPVC or aluminium. uPVC is the most sought-after option, since it has a an attractive appearance and is also affordable. However, it is not as durable as other materials, and could require some maintenance. Timber is a great choice for those who love the classic appearance, but it will deteriorate over time. Aluminium is a new material that is becoming a popular alternative to timber, since it's more weatherproof and has the same durability.

Bay and bow windows extend from the home. They must be insulated to meet the building codes of the region. Incorrect installation could lead to draughts, moisture issues, and loss of heat. Conservatories

Conservatories are a wonderful addition to any home. They are a great way to add space to an eating area or a living room. They can also be a place to grow plants. It is important to maintain your conservatory properly regardless of what you do with it. Keep it clean. If you observe signs that it has been damaged by water or rot it's time to upgrade it.

A lot of conservatories that are being used were constructed over a decade ago, and the specifications for the product did not take into account energy efficiency and climate control was not a primary concern. They are usually too hot in summer and too cold in the winter. It can be expensive to heat the conservatory, and it could be a poor place to live.

To resolve this issue, you can replace your glass and windows with modern materials. Insulation can also improve the temperature in your conservatory. The process of adding insulation to walls can be a challenge due to building regulations and foundation restrictions.
